France hijacks masks and other PPE intended for EU: https://www.irishtimes.com/news/world/europe/coronavirus-eur...

“On March 3rd, President Emmanuel Macron announced that he was requisitioning ‘all stocks and the production of protective masks’ for distribution to medical personnel and French people infected with Covid-19. One fifth of all surgical procedures in the EU use personal protective equipment imported from Asia by the Swedish company Mölnlycke. The company’s main distribution warehouse for southern Europe, Belgium and the Netherlands is in Lyon.”
